Website Background

Moto Repuestos Monterrey
En MRM somos mayoristas líderes en el mercado de refacciones, accesorios y equipo de protección para las motocicletas de trabajo con mayor demanda en México. Nos enfocamos en atender refaccionarias, boutiques y corporativos que buscan ofrecer calidad en sus productos y garantía en su servicio.
